Output 57eb18e650bac458950b68ec3dfb300429eb8e3438f8d412761ef3bbb64b889e:1

value
31675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375bda5c05dee0293ce2dadc225364fb7b21a OP_EQUAL
address
3BMEXaUxyCtnLKVy7Ee5ezAV46mJ3xVaNF
transaction
57eb18e650bac458950b68ec3dfb300429eb8e3438f8d412761ef3bbb64b889e
confirmations
390552
spent
true